Our senior DT challenge this month was an exciting one! Mix and match at least four different patterns on our project! I kind of pulled this off in a more classic way than you would think of mixing patterns. I wanted a more tailored look. Maybe because that is what I am more comfortable with. So I pulled together like colors and pattern sizes. I think that is the key. Especially in the size of the patterns. Try to keep them around the same size, and you will tend to be a bit more successful if you are nervous about this at all.
Since I used the paper as the main focal point of this card set, I didn’t want it to overload the card. So I only continued halfway down the card with the patterned paper to give it more balance. By doing this, it also helps to show off the insides of the cards, which have full sheets of differing patterned paper.
framing and using the large Dark Chocolate buttons were also a fun element. This is a nice option in a set of thank you cards for when you send a card to a woman or a man.
I finished up my card collection by housing it in a My Timeless Template “Captured Card Case.” I know this template is a favorite for MANY people, and I just love it as well. I just mimicked my card fronts for the top of the box and added a Trademarks stamp along with my button. A nice finish to a tailored card set. Hope you enjoyed it!
